Revenue has compounded at 4.5% per year over the past 19 years to 3.87 B THB. Earnings per share have declined at 0.0% per year over the last 16 years.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L's net margin stands at 15.5%, broadly stable from 16.0% several years earlier.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L currently offers a dividend yield of about 6.80%. The payout ratio is around 60% of earnings. Analysts set a median price target of 15.91 THB, implying 61.5% above the current price. Of 7 analysts, 6 rate the stock a buy — an overall Buy consensus. The stock trades about 13% above its 52-week low.

Total Return vs. Price Return

The "Total Return" toggle includes reinvested dividends on top of the pure price movement. This is critical because dividends can account for a significant portion of long-term returns. Historically, roughly 40 % of the S&P 500's total return has come from dividends. Always compare total return when evaluating a stock's real performance against a benchmark.

Gross Margin

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.

EBIT and EBIT Margin

E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.

What Is Fair Value?

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.

Earnings-Based Fair Value

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.

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021

Revenue-Based Fair Value

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"

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021

Dividend-Based Fair Value

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.

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021

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L is an internationally operating manufacturer of pressure vessels based in Thailand. The company specializes in the development and production of high-quality pressure vessels for use in the gas industry, chemical industry, petrochemical industry, food industry, pharmaceutical and biotechnology industry, as well as for plasma and laser applications. The company produces a wide range of pressure vessels, from small laboratory containers for research purposes to large high-pressure containers for industrial applications. The business model of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L is based on three main divisions: 1. Pressure vessels for the gas industry: The company produces a variety of gas cylinders used for the storage of industrial and medical gases. These containers are designed to meet the highest safety requirements and are used worldwide for the transportation and storage of gases. 2. Pressure vessels for chemical and petrochemical applications: Sahamitr Pressure Container PCL also manufactures pressure vessels for use in the chemical and petrochemical industry. These containers are designed for pressures of up to 350 bar and are used for the storage of liquids and gases such as ethylene, ammonia, and hydrogen peroxide. 3. Pressure vessels for pharmaceutical, biotechnology, and plasma treatment: The company also produces pressure vessels for the pharmaceutical and biotechnology industry. These containers are used for fermentation and reaction processes and adhere to the highest hygiene standards. Another important application area is pressure vessels for plasma treatment, which are used for a wide range of applications such as surface treatment, sterilization, and waste decontamination.
